heptane, 1,7-diiodo- - Physico-chemical Properties
Molecular Formula | C7H14I2
|
Molar Mass | 351.99 |
Density | 1.9477 (rough estimate) |
Boling Point | 298.28°C (estimate) |
Flash Point | 138.231°C |
Vapor Presure | 0.002mmHg at 25°C |
Refractive Index | 1.4876 (estimate) |
